Lindorm Streams memungkinkan Anda berlangganan perubahan inkremental—penyisipan, pembaruan, dan penghapusan—pada tabel Lindorm serta mendorong perubahan tersebut secara real time ke topik Message Queue for Apache Kafka. Setelah aliran Lindorm diaktifkan pada suatu tabel, fitur pelacakan perubahan akan mencatat setiap operasi data dan mengirimkan catatan event ke topik Kafka yang Anda tentukan.
Prasyarat
Sebelum memulai, pastikan Anda telah:
Menambahkan alamat IP client Lindorm dan client Message Queue for Apache Kafka ke daftar putih instans Lindorm Anda. Lihat Konfigurasi daftar putih.
Menghubungkan instans Lindorm sumber dan instans Message Queue for Apache Kafka tujuan ke Lindorm Tunnel Service (LTS). Lihat Koneksi jaringan.
Membuat sumber data LindormTable. Lihat Tambahkan sumber data LindormTable.
Membuat sumber data Kafka. Lihat Tambahkan sumber data Kafka.
Mengaktifkan fitur pelacakan perubahan. Lihat Aktifkan pelacakan perubahan.
Buat aliran Lindorm
Masuk ke antarmuka pengguna web (UI) LTS instans Lindorm Anda. Di panel navigasi sebelah kiri, pilih Change Data Capture > Push.

Klik create, lalu konfigurasikan parameter yang dijelaskan dalam tabel berikut.
Parameter Deskripsi Tipe Bawaan Lindorm Cluster Pilih sumber data LindormTable yang telah Anda buat. — — The table name. Masukkan nama tabel yang data inkrementalnya ingin Anda langgani, dalam format Namespace.NamaTabel. Contohnya:ns1.table1berlangganan ketable1di namespacens1;ns2.*berlangganan ke semua tabel di namespacens2.String — Stream Config – key_onlyAtur ke trueuntuk hanya mengekspor nilai kunci primary.Boolean falseStream Config – order_outputAtur ke trueuntuk mencatat operasi penyisipan, penghapusan, dan pembaruan secara berurutan berdasarkan nilai kunci primary.Boolean falseMessageStorage Type Pilih KAFKA.— — Storage Datasource Pilih sumber data Kafka yang telah Anda buat. — — MessageStorage Config – kafka_topicMasukkan nama topik Message Queue for Apache Kafka tempat data pelacakan perubahan dikirimkan. String — MessageVersion Format data untuk catatan aliran. String DebeziumV1Message Config – old_imageAtur ke trueuntuk menyertakan data baris sebelum operasi dalam setiap catatan aliran. Jika diaktifkan, catatan UPDATE dan DELETE akan membawa nilai bidang asli. Jika diatur kefalse, data baris sebelum operasi tidak disertakan dalam catatan aliran.Boolean trueMessage Config – new_imageAtur ke trueuntuk menyertakan data baris setelah operasi dalam setiap catatan aliran. Jika diaktifkan, catatan INSERT dan UPDATE akan membawa nilai bidang hasil operasi.Boolean true
Klik Commit.